Honda Ridgeline Owners Club, forum community to discuss reviews, accessories, …Regardless of whicH2006 Honda Ridgeline configuration You may have, Your truck will sit on P245/65R17 tires. The wheels measure 17 inches in diameter by 7.5 inches in width; more specifically, the rim size iS7.5J X17 ET 45. The bolt pattern iS5x120, with A64.1mm center bore. This is universal; all '06 Ridgeline models will share the same specifications. It would click instantly.Jun 10, 2023 · Let’s start with a quick answer: All generations of the Honda Ridgeline have a bolt pattern of 5×4.72 inches (5x120mm), a center bore of 2.52 inches (64.1mm), and five lug nuts with a thread size of M14 x 1.5 that need to be tightened with 93.7lb-ft (127Nm) of force. Use a torque wrench: It is highly recommended to use a torque wrench to tighten your lug nuts. This tool allows you to accurately measure the torque applied and avoid over-tightening or under-tightening. 2. Tighten in a star pattern: When tightening the lug nuts, follow a star pattern.
